  • Verapamil hydrochloride is a calcium antagonist or slow-channel inhibitor
  • The solution contains no bacteriostat or antimicrobial agent and is intended for single-dose intravenous administration
  • The antiarrhythmic effect of verapamil appears to be due to its effect on the slow channel in cells of the cardiac conduction system
  • The vasodilatory effect of verapamil appears to be due to its effect on blockade of calcium channels as well as receptors
